BRIDGEVILLE, PA. — Construction is complete for Phase I of Bursca Frontgate, a retail center located at the entrance to Bursca Business Park in Bridgeville. Phase I consists of a 7,800-square-foot building, of which the New Dragon Express restaurant and Sudsy's Beer Distributor have already leased a combined 4,400 square feet. Future plans call for an additional building totaling 6,000 square feet. Burns & Scalo Real Estate Services is leasing the property.

SOUTHOLD, N.Y. — Stalco Construction has completed the $1.5 million expansion and renovation of the IGA Supermarket located at 54566 Route 25 in Southold. The project included the demolition and reconstruction of the building exterior, a new roof, the reconfiguration of the interior space and other improvements. John A. Grillo, Architect PC served as project architect. The building is owned by Thomas and Charles Reichert.
CHERRY HILL, N.J. — Colliers International has brokered the sale of a single-story, 4,000-square-foot retail building located at 1734 Route 70 in Cherry Hill. The buyer, Dr. Evan Sorokin, plans to relocate his practice to the building from its current location in Marlton, N.J. David Reibstein and David Dunkelman of Colliers' Philadelphia office represented the seller, 1734 Route 70 East LLC. Evan Zweben of Colliers' Mount Laurel, N.J., office represented the buyer.
AUSTIN, TEXAS — An Austin-based investment partnership has purchased the 69,336-square-foot Rivertowne Mall from a private party for an undisclosed amount. The property is located on 5.58 acres at 2003-2017 Riverside Drive in Austin. The buyer is planning to redevelop the project into traditional retail space. Walter Saad, Cathy Nabours and Eric DeJernett of CB Richard Ellis' Austin office represented the seller.
HOUSTON — The Houston office of Holliday Fenoglio Fowler (HFF) has closed the sale of The Commons at Presidio Square, a 189,340-square-foot shopping center located at the intersection of Highway 6 and Bellaire Boulevard in Houston. The shopping center, which sits on 22.5 acres, is anchored by H-E-B and is currently 89.9 percent leased with major tenants such as RadioShack, IHOP and JPMorgan Chase. HFF's Rusty Tamlyn and Trent Agnew lead the investment sales team on behalf of the seller, Camden Securities. Canadian-based North American Development Group purchased the property and assumed the in-place financing.
CRYSTAL LAKE AND AURORA, ILL. — Marc Rubin of Zifkin Realty Group represented Monkey Joes, a children's entertainment center, in two lease transactions. The company leased 15,122 square feet at Crystal Lake Shopping Center in Crystal Lake and 16,360 square feet at Yorkshire Plaza in Aurora. Scott Tucker of Kimco Realty represented the undisclosed landlord in both transactions.
MARLBOROUGH, MASS. — The Capital Markets group of Colliers Meredith & Grew has arranged a $9 million loan for the refinancing of Post Road Plaza in Marlborough. The 209,657-square-foot shopping center is located at 246 E. Main St. It is 98 percent leased to a tenant roster that includes Marshalls, CVS/pharmacy, Price Chopper and Ocean State Job Lot. John Broderick of Colliers represented the borrower, Karnak Realty. The loan carries a 20-year term and a fixed interest rate. The lender is Aviva Investors, a subsidiary of Aviva plc.
LEE, N.H. — Fantini & Gorga has arranged $3.36 million in permanent financing for a Walgreen's pharmacy located at 91 Calef Highway in Lee. The lender in the deal was aMassachusetts banking institution. The borrower was Calef Highway Lee LLC.
HOUSTON — Marcus & Millichap Real Estate Investment Services has sold Long Point Shopping Center, a 41,731-square-foot retail property in Houston. Located at 7922 Long Point Road, the property consists of a KFC/Taco Bell and three freestanding retail buildings. Chris Maling of Marcus & Millichap's Los Angeles office and Todd A. Carlson of the firm's Houston office had the exclusive listing to the property on behalf of the seller, a California-based private investor. The buyer, a Texas-based private investor, was secured by Carlson.
HOUSTON — Tuscon, Ariz.-based Pima Medical Institute (PMI) has leased 42,297 square feet of space within Katy Freeway Retail Center I, located at 10201 Katy Freeway in Houston, for a new campus facility slated to open in September. PMI is a private, family-owned, accredited medical school with 13 campuses throughout New Mexico, Arizona, Colorado, Washington, Nevada and California. James Wachholz of UGL Equis's Denver office worked with William Wolff of the firm's Houston office to secure the lease.
